~/.config/wofi/config file is:
mode=drun,run
run-always_parse_args=true
term=foot
allow_images=true
hide_scroll=true
insensitive=true
prompt=
height=40%
width=20%
~/.config/wofi/style.css file is very basic with black & white colors:
#input {
background-color: #1c1c1c;
border: 2px solid #bcbcbc;
border-radius: 0;
color: #bcbcbc;
}
#scroll {
background-color: #1c1c1c;
border: 2px solid #bcbcbc;
border-top-width: 0;
color: #6c6c6c;
}
#entry:selected {
background-color: #5f87af;
color: #bcbcbc;
}
